From Arcade to Open-World: A Dive into Racing Game Variety

Racing games have been a popular genre in the world of video games for decades. From the early days of pixelated graphics and simple controls to the stunningly realistic simulations we have today, racing games have come a long way. In this article, we will explore sub-genres within the racing genre, discuss the key elements that make a racing game exciting, and ultimately understand why these games continue to captivate players of all ages. 

Sub-Genres of Racing Games

In the world of racing games, there are different types that suit various tastes and styles of play. Some of the popular ones include: 

Realistic Simulations

Realistic simulation racing games strive to provide players with an authentic and true-to-life racing experience. These games focus on accurately recreating the physics, mechanics, and dynamics of real-world racing. They often feature licensed vehicles, meticulously modeled tracks, and advanced customization options. Realistic simulations attract hardcore racing enthusiasts who appreciate the challenge of mastering realistic racing techniques and crave high accuracy and attention to detail. 

According to James Madigan, author of Getting Gamers: The Psychology of Video Games, the players of horror games can be classified into two groups. The first group comprises players drawn to these games for the immersive experience, seeking thrills and the adrenaline rush they provide. The second group consists of players motivated by the social aspect of playing horror games. It is suggested that the social element plays a significant role in driving these players to engage in such games, whether to impress others or to project an image of toughness. However, it is intriguing to note that the first group’s motivation stems from their personal experiences and emotional responses to the game. In contrast, the second group’s motivation is predominantly centered around the social aspect and the impact of playing the game on their own social standing.  

Arcade Racing

Arcade racing games, unlike realistic simulations, prioritize fast-paced action, accessibility, and a sense of fun. These games offer a more relaxed and less demanding approach to racing, often incorporating elements like power-ups, stunts, and exaggerated physics. Arcade racers are known for their thrilling and over-the-top experiences, appealing to casual gamers and those seeking an adrenaline rush. Like its name, these games are often found in your local arcades. 

Open-World Racing

Open-world racing games provide players with vast, sprawling environments to explore and race in. These games offer freedom and allow players to navigate expansive cities, countryside, or fictional worlds. Open-world racers often feature realistic and arcade-style gameplay elements, combining the joy of exploration with the excitement of high-speed racing. 

Kart Racing

Kart racing games center around small, agile vehicles inspired by go-karts. These games are typically light-hearted and family-friendly, featuring colorful characters, whimsical tracks, and imaginative power-ups. Kart racing games emphasize fun and friendly competition rather than hyper-realistic racing mechanics. That’s why this genre is often associated with another genre, party games. 

Off-Road and Rally

Off-road and rally racing games take the action away from classic tracks and into rugged, challenging terrains. These games feature vehicles for rough terrain, such as rally cars, trucks, or dirt bikes. Off-road racers often incorporate realistic physics, unpredictable weather conditions, and demanding courses that require precise control and strategy. 

How to Make an Exciting Racing Game

Gameplay Mechanics

The core gameplay mechanics should be tight, responsive, and intuitive. Controls should feel natural and allow players to have precise control over their vehicles. Balancing realism with accessibility is important, as players should feel challenged yet not overwhelmed. Incorporate features like drifting, drafting, and boosting to add depth and excitement to the gameplay. 

Variety of Tracks and Environments

Offer various tracks and environments to keep the gameplay fresh and engaging. Create diverse settings like city streets, countryside roads, mountain passes, and off-road tracks. Vary the difficulty level and incorporate different weather conditions, time of day, and dynamic environments that impact gameplay. This variety adds replayability and keeps players engaged. The developer can explore the variety even further to emphasize the game theme. For example, if they create a racing game in a medieval setting, they can create a racing track inside a castle. It can be jarring initially, but it’ll add uniqueness to the game. 

Vehicle Selection and Customization

Provide a diverse selection of vehicles with characteristics and performance attributes. Offer a range of vehicle types, from sports to off-road vehicles, and allow players to customize and upgrade their vehicles. Customization options can include visual enhancements, performance modifications, and tuning settings. These options allow players to personalize their experience and feel a sense of ownership over their vehicles. 

Multiplayer Modes

Incorporate multiplayer modes to allow players to compete against each other. Online multiplayer allows global competition, while local multiplayer enables friends to race together. Implement features like leaderboards, matchmaking systems, and competitive rankings to encourage friendly competition and social interaction among players. 

Stunning Visuals and Audio

Invest in high-quality graphics and visual effects to create a visually stunning racing game. Pay attention to details such as realistic vehicle models, a sense of speed, detailed environments, and impressive particle effects. Additionally, dynamic lighting, weather effects, and realistic sound design contribute to the overall immersion and excitement of the game. 

Progression and Rewards

Design a rewarding progression system that keeps players engaged and motivated. Implement a variety of challenges, events, and tournaments to offer a sense of achievement and progression. Reward players with unlockable content, such as new vehicles, tracks, customization options, and game modes, as they advance through the game. 

Innovative Features and Game Modes

Introduce innovative features and game modes that differentiate your racing game from others. These features can include unique power-ups, special abilities, alternative game modes like time trials or elimination races, or even non-traditional racing experiences. These additions can add a fresh twist to the genre and provide a unique selling point for your game. 

By focusing on these elements, you can create an exciting racing game that keeps players engaged, immersed, and coming back for more. Remember to prioritize gameplay mechanics, offer a variety of tracks and vehicles, incorporate multiplayer modes, and deliver stunning visuals and audio. Ultimately, the key to an exciting racing game lies in providing a thrilling and immersive experience that captures the joy and adrenaline of high-speed racing. 

Agate is currently crafting an adrenaline-pumping racing game that will have players on the edge of their seats, Stellarace. In this unique and exhilarating adventure, you’ll glide across alien landscapes, navigating treacherous twists and turns with precision and speed. With stunning visuals and immersive gameplay, Agate’s Stellarce promises to transport players to a world unlike any they’ve seen before.  

Get a taste of the excitement and be the first to experience the rollerblading sensation by trying out the demo available on Steam. 

Play Video


In conclusion, racing games have evolved over the years, offering a variety of sub-genres to cater to different player preferences. From realistic simulations to arcade thrills, open-world exploration to kart racing and off-road challenges, there is something for everyone in the world of racing games. To create an exciting racing game, developers should focus on core gameplay mechanics, offering a variety of tracks and environments, providing vehicle selection and customization options, incorporating multiplayer modes, delivering stunning visuals and audio, designing rewarding progression systems, and introducing innovative features and game modes. Agate’s upcoming racing game, Stellarace, exemplifies the excitement and innovation that can be achieved in the genre. With its unique rollerblading concept and immersive gameplay, Stellarace promises to take players on an unforgettable racing adventure. Be sure to try out the demo on Steam and prepare to be swept away by the thrill of high-speed rollerblading on an alien planet. 

Are you looking for co-development, art services, or game porting? Look no further than Agate!

Don’t hesitate to get in touch with us today and learn more about how we can help you take your project to exceptional heights.